What Exactly Is Smart Preconditioning?
Smart Preconditioning is Tesla’s intelligent system that allows the car to condition its battery and cabin climate before you even start the vehicle. Unlike traditional preconditioning, which fully activates heating or cooling while plugged in, Smart Preconditioning intelligently manages energy use — warming or cooling the battery and interior using minimal power before driving begins.
This significantly reduces energy consumption during your drive, effectively extending your vehicle’s range and enhancing battery longevity—no one has to live without climate control or sacrifice range for comfort.

How Does Smart Preconditioning Work?
Thanks to Tesla’s advanced energy management, Smart Preconditioning leverages key data inputs:
- Weather forecasts and current ambient temperature
- Historical driving patterns
- Battery state of charge and health
- Planned route data (via navigation)
Using machine learning, the car calculates the optimal time and duration to begin preconditioning while still connected to a charger. For example, if you’re heading into cold weather in the morning, Tesla preconditions the battery and cabin efficiently, drawing power during off-peak hours when electricity is cheaper and the battery is at an ideal temperature for peak performance.
Crucially, Tesla ensures this process uses only the energy needed—keeping your vehicle energy-efficient without sacrificing comfort.

Why Smart Preconditioning Is a Game-Changer
1. Smarter Energy Use = Longer Range
Heating, for instance, can drain up to 30% more battery in freezing conditions. Smart Preconditioning ensures the battery starts warm—maximizing efficiency during the drive, curbing unnecessary energy drain, and preserving range. This is no small gain for long commutes or cold-weather adventures.
2. Reduces Grid Strain
By enabling preconditioning during off-peak electricity hours (when Tesla integrates smart scheduling), Tesla helps reduce peak load on the power grid—benefiting both homeowners and the environment.
3. Enhances Battery Longevity
Extreme cold or heat accelerates battery degradation. Preconditioning keeps your battery within its optimal temperature zone, contributing to longer battery life and reliability over time.
4. Seamless, Invisible Convenience
Tesla’s system operates in the background. You set your destination and time—then wake up to a comfortably conditioned car ready to roll. No manual climate tweaks. No range anxiety before you even leave home.
